India Waits on Bumrah Fitness for Sri Lanka Tests

India's cricket team is likely to adopt a wait-and-see approach regarding the fitness of key fast bowler Jasprit Bumrah for the upcoming Test series against Sri Lanka.

The 32-year-old pacer was included in the squad led by Shubman Gill, but his participation is contingent upon receiving a fitness clearance. Bumrah had missed the third One-Day International (ODI) against England at Lord's due to an impact injury to his left knee.

Despite the injury, Bumrah had shown promising form in the two matches he played against England, looking sharp and causing problems for the opposition batsmen. His fitness will be closely monitored in the lead-up to the Sri Lanka Tests.
